Nigeria Real Estate Market Overview – Lagos Property Landscape

The Lagos property market remains a vibrant hub within Nigeria, marked by a significant demand for housing across various segments . Present patterns reveal a mix of possibilities and difficulties , with prime locations in Ikoyi, VI and Banana Island continuing to command high prices. Low-cost accommodation remains a crucial concern, fueling development in up-and-coming areas like Lekki Peninsula and Epe. Funding activity is robust , generating both domestic and international participants, but interest rates and economic conditions continue to impact asset prices.

Land for Disposal in this Country: Desirable Locations & Investment Opportunities

The Nigerian real estate landscape presents compelling avenues for both local and international buyers. Right now, major cities like Lagos, Abuja, and Port Harcourt remain extremely sought-after spots for property purchase. Particularly, areas in Banana Island (Lagos) and Asokoro (Abuja) present luxury living and business premises, drawing substantial yields. Yet, emerging towns such as Ibadan also hold significant potential and could offer more budget-friendly investment options. Careful due diligence and professional advice are vital before making any land purchase. Evaluating elements such as infrastructure, protection, and growth is also critical for maximizing the business return.

Property in Nigeria for Rent: Affordable Options & Rental Trends

Finding a right property for hire in Nigeria can feel overwhelming, but affordable options certainly exist. Recent rental trends show the blend of high-demand areas like Lagos and Abuja, where prices usually be higher than in other cities and villages. Nonetheless, you can still find good value with meticulous searching. Here's a quick overview at the expect:

  • Key Cities: Expect more rental costs mainly around popular neighborhoods.
  • Lesser Towns: Provide more affordable options.
  • Negotiation is Key: Do not be reluctant to haggle the hire.
  • Think about joint property: This can considerably lower a hire fees.

Keep in mind that thoroughly check the available property prior to agreeing to any rental contract.
